Upon Completion of the course, you will be able to
1. Explain the key objectives of the Reporting of Injuries, Diseases and Dangerous Occurrences Regulations (RIDDOR).
2. Discuss the importance of RIDDOR in promoting workplace safety and compliance with legal requirements.
3. Explain the potential legal consequences of failing to comply with RIDDOR regulations.
4. List the types of injuries, diseases, and dangerous occurrences that must be reported under RIDDOR.
5. Describe the steps and methods for reporting incidents under RIDDOR, including online reporting and telephone reporting.
